Feel free to add one, if it contains new unique information. @section best-practices-gles GLES-specific +- Rendering to RGB textures doesn't work on many platforms, either due to + alignment issues or other factors. For example it is not possible to render + to @ref TextureFormat::RGB8 on iOS (but it works elsewhere); rendering to + @ref TextureFormat::RGB32F is not possible even on NVidia. Use RGBA formats + instead. - [Writing Portable OpenGL ES 2.0](https://www.khronos.org/assets/uploads/developers/library/2011-siggraph-mobile/Writing-Portable-OpenGL-ES-2.0_Aug-11.pdf) @section best-practices-platform Platform-specific @@ -45,11 +50,23 @@ information. @subsection best-practices-mac macOS +- @ref AbstractShaderProgram::validate() expects that the shader has a + properly configured framebuffer bound along with proper @ref Renderer + setup.
